Subject: [RFC PATCH 5/5] powerpc: sstep: Add selftests for addc[.] instruction
Date: Mon,  4 Feb 2019 09:48:39 +0530	[thread overview]
Message-ID: <9460deae6525f983b6ab44e3e35c1bbbd79d3ef5.1549253769.git.sandipan@linux.ibm.com> (raw)
In-Reply-To: <cover.1549253769.git.sandipan@linux.ibm.com>

This adds test cases for the addc[.] instruction.

Signed-off-by: Sandipan Das <sandipan@linux.ibm.com>
---
 arch/powerpc/include/asm/ppc-opcode.h |   1 +
 arch/powerpc/lib/sstep_tests.c        | 212 ++++++++++++++++++++++++++
 2 files changed, 213 insertions(+)

diff --git a/arch/powerpc/include/asm/ppc-opcode.h b/arch/powerpc/include/asm/ppc-opcode.h
index 07bdb404571c..c0fe90173977 100644
--- a/arch/powerpc/include/asm/ppc-opcode.h
+++ b/arch/powerpc/include/asm/ppc-opcode.h
@@ -326,6 +326,7 @@
 #define PPC_INST_ADDI			0x38000000
 #define PPC_INST_ADDIS			0x3c000000
 #define PPC_INST_ADD			0x7c000214
+#define PPC_INST_ADDC			0x7c000014
 #define PPC_INST_SUB			0x7c000050
 #define PPC_INST_BLR			0x4e800020
 #define PPC_INST_BLRL			0x4e800021
